How is the weather in Kassel?
Kassel experiences chilly winters around 29–40°F (-2–5°C), while summers are mild to warm with highs of 70–74°F (21–24°C). Rain is possible year-round, so packing a rain jacket is often suggested.

What is Kassel known for?
Kassel is known for its UNESCO-listed Bergpark Wilhelmshöhe, the Hercules monument, and as the home of the international contemporary art exhibition, documenta. The city has a long literary heritage and impressive public gardens.

What are the best foods to try in Kassel?
Locally rooted dishes include Ahle Wurst, hearty potato-based specialties, and seasonal cakes available at bakeries and markets. Many visitors also enjoy tasting regional cheeses and apple beverages from surrounding areas.
